The place I typically get Chinese food still hasn't reopened so I decided to try this place out for the first time. They have a good size menu with lots of variety. They've taken great precautions to protect customers during this pandemic. I decided to order a smorgasbord of items to test them out and so I could get a feel for their good. First, appetizers. I ordered two: crab Rangoon and chicken wings. I always order Rangoons and I'm undecided about theirs. Maybe they were just too greasy throwing the taste off? They weren't terrible but they weren't a favorite. I'd absolutely not recommend the wings. It's a weird thing to get at a Chinese restaurant but other places have great ones so I wanted to test these out. Don't. They obviously cooked them long enough they were dry but they had a funny taste. The skin of the had yellow and then they had congealed/dried blood on each of them. I threw them away when I got home. I ordered two dinners from their combination section: Chicken Chow Mein and Beef and broccoli. I've had the chow Mein at Panda Express and love it. I did not love theirs. It reminded me of the chow Mein that my mom made me eat out of the can as a child. And maybe it's the way it's supposed to be, I just didn't like it. It came with a dry noodle but they were stale. It also came with pork fried rice and egg roll. The rice was ok, not my favorite. The egg roll was different.The beef and broccoli was good. The beef was tender and the veggies were cooked well. This combined with the rice was good. If I didn't want to drive to Lima for Panda Express, I would come here and get this dish again. I would avoid the deep fried items because they were too greasy. The prices are really good and you get a lot of food. They obviously do a good business because there were quite a few pickups while I waited.

If you're in need of a quick cheap bite, this place is for you.Did the buffet for dinner (ONLY 8$!!!)Soup- hot and sour- won ton (though didn't have any won tons in it)- egg dropMain line- probably around 10 entree items - about 7 different proteins without veggies- some fried seafood. Some raw shrimp available- white or fried rice- lo meinDid have dessert on the buffet- 5ish different ice cream/ sherbet flavors- jello, pudding- donuts- biscuits/short bread cookiesService to clear tables of plates was a little slow, plates built up rather quickly toward the end of the mealPlace felt old and tired, but not dirty (including bathrooms)Price here is definitely a factor. Not the best Chinese food I've had, but with that price I would be tempted to come back if I was hungry enough. There was not an entree on the line that stood out. All were average.
